Research Areas
The department has research areas in:
- Econometrics and Quantitative Methods
- Economic History, Law and Economics
- Financial Economics
- Industrial Organization
- International Economics
- Labour, Health, Education and Welfare
- Macroeconomics and Monetary Economics
- Microeconomics
- Public and Development Economics
- Urban, Environmental and Natural Resource Economics
